Dqs knowledge base data download

Using knowledge to cleanse data with data quality services. Existing knowledge base there is a builtin dqs data knowledge base which comes with the installation and it contains some data about countries regions and us states. Dqs enables you to use both computerassisted and interactive processes to create, build, and update your knowledge base. However, knowing now that a new id is created every time we cross the deployment line, ssis will never be able to maintain sync with the dqs knowledgebase id number, as it is only natural that dev will have many more releases than. Lets create a knowledge base and attach a composite domain to the melissa data addresscheck service. In addition, you need to prepare some demo data in advance. To learn more about the knowledge base or knowledge discovery and the process of creating a knowledge base, refer to my earlier tip in this series. We join the data source to the dqs cleansing control and double click the control to open and edit it.

It shows adding new domains and using knowledge discovery to add values to the domains. The knowledge discovery activity builds the knowledge base by analyzing a sample of data for data quality criteria, looking for data inconsistencies and syntax errors, and proposing changes to the data. My friend and sql server expert govind kanshi have written an excellent article on this subject earlier on his blog. Creating the knowledge base with the release of sql server 2012, one of the great features that we gain is the ability to manage data quality much easier, and without building something custom. In data quality services, the equivalent to a database which we are all familiar with is called a knowledge base. Automating the data matching process in sql server data. When youre using dqs, the data is cleansed according to the rules youve built up in the dqs knowledge base. Deduplicating data with sql server 2012 data quality services.

Data quality with dqs components in integration services. Customers certificates audits auditfiles documents br no. Using the dqs default knowledge base data quality services. This recipe assumes that you have built the dqs knowledge base from the previous recipe. In this case i have named it testknowledge base and it will be brand new knowledge base.

A dqs kb is a grouping of related data quality definitions and rules called domains that are defined up front. As you update the knowledge base with better rules, your overall data quality goes up. The dqs administrator cannot install the server or add new users. Sql server data quality services dqs is a knowledge driven data quality product aimed at the data stewards and it professionals who seek to improve the quality of their business data. Apr 28, 2012 removing a redundant dqs knowledge base data quality services client. Im trying to build a knowledge base in sql server 2012 dqs. In the dqs client home screen, under knowledge base management, click new knowledge base. A dqs kb is the place where you store the knowledge about the data and the cleansing in order to speed up the regular cleansing process. In the raw data that i am trying to run through dqs, ive got a field that is a full name field that unfortunately can hold both human and. A straightforward, nononsense approach to improving your data cleansing skills with sql server data quality services dqs. May 04, 2016 create dqs knowledge base if you have to import a lot of data into your lob databases and the data can be unclean, dqs is a powerful tool that can help with the process of cleansing that data. Importing values into dqs domains from excel, and gratitude. Automating data deduplication using dqs and ssis wellyslee.

We will demonstrate a variety of critical data quality activities such as knowledge discovery, domain management, matching policies for. Data cleansing with dqs sql server 2017 integration. Base button and select the knowledge base dqs data in the following dialog. Data quality services is a knowledge driven solution that analyzes data based upon knowledge that builds with dqs. I am using another excel sheet here for simplicity purpose. The number will vary every time that you change and publish the dqs knowledge base kb.

An introduction to data quality towards data science. With the release of microsofts data quality services in 2012, it is natural that we should assume that the progression of creating and publishing rules and domains for our data quality. Dec 31, 2014 in this case i have named it testknowledge base and it will be brand new knowledge base. Before creating a ssis data flow that uses dqs for automatic data cleansing, a knowledge base has to be created and domain knowledge implemented.

This database contains all the dqs stored procedures for the dqs engine, and the published data quality knowledge base information that comes with dqs. Open the dqs client application, connect to the dqs server and create a new knowledge base. Create dqs knowledge base if you have to import a lot of data into your lob databases and the data can be unclean, dqs is a powerful tool that can help with the process of cleansing that data. In ssms, use the following query to prepare the data. Sql server windows only azure sql database azure synapse analytics sql dw parallel data warehouse this topic describes the default knowledge base, dqs data, which is installed with data quality services dqs. After you configured the reference data services settings in dqs, you need to attach and map the rds to a specific domain in your knowledge base. Data cleaning in sql 2012 with data quality services. Then you need to do the matching based on similarity of attributes, for example, names and addresses. Dqs knowledge bases and domains data quality services dqs.

Lets start with a dqs knowledge base and a domain in microsoft data quality services. You can improve data quality in your ssis data flows by using the dqs cleansing transform new in sql 2012. Data quality services dqs security management crm hunts. In sql server, dqs is one of the tools that can help you with this task. Deduplicating data with sql server 2012 data quality. It involves creating a data quality services dqs knowledge base and matching policy, and then using this matching policy. Dqs enables you to build a knowledge base and use it to perform a variety of. To get the list of counties, go to the ordnance survey sparql api at. Let me do a small intro to dqs so that you have context. I am going to create a knowledge base, which will have my definitive list of counties, then i am going to try to clean the land registry data with this knowledge base. In this first example i will keep the knowledge base as simple as possible for clarity and better understanding. Dqs knowledge bases and domains data quality services. Creating a knowledge base and cleansing data using data. Sep 04, 2012 clicking next will publish the knowledge base which is just created.

Data quality services is an addon for sql server that will help you build a customized knowledge base for correcting, standardizing, and deduplicating your data. Data cleaning in sql 2012 with data quality services simple. The task allows you to publish a knowledge base, which is. Assume that you use the data quality services dqs feature in microsoft sql server. This is a prebuilt default knowledge base that contains the following domains. We can do this with a tool called data quality services, and using it is as easy as 123. Aug 21, 2012 data quality services is very interesting enhancements in sql server 2012.

With this custom transform task, you can use the knowledge base kb created in dqs to automate data matching through ssis. Data are accurate when data values stored in the database. There are two other options under the create knowledge base from tab. Apr 04, 2014 oh22 data has just released a free ssis transform task for sql server data quality services dqs matching. Dqs knowledge base management create or maintain data quality knowledge base new knowledge base open knowledge base sql server data quality services data quality projects create or maintain data quality project new data quality project open data quality project hello, v2bdqsaadministrator local sign out administration. The customer database shows all certified customers of dqs group with their certificates as pdf download. This demo shows creating a knowledge base using sql server 2012s data quality services.

My knowledge base is going to be a list of counties in the uk. In this example, i am going to create a new knowledge base of counties. To begin the process of cleansing data with dqs, you need to perform two primary steps within the knowledge base management pane. Standards sector type of request select filled corporate form to upload.

Nov 09, 2016 in this blog post, you are going to see how to use sql server data quality services to ensure the correct aggregation of data. We will try to take any random data and attempt to do dqs implementation over it. Cleansing data is the process of comparing new data against known and verified values to make sure that the new data meets expectations and is entered consistently. Creating a dqs knowledge base sql server 2017 integration. Technet adventureworks sample for data quality services dqs. This analysis is based on algorithms built into dqs. Data quality services dqs cleansing transformation ssis. Microsoft sql server data quality services dqs element61. You can download the excel addin either from the home page of the hedda. With this custom transform task, you can create a matching rules as a dqs knowledge base kb and use the kb to perform data deduplication through ssis. In addition to the data flow component, the publish dqs knowledge base task belongs to the project.

Similar to standard data quality processes in dqs, you have to perform the matching by building a knowledge base. How to add reference data services in data quality services dqs. The knowledge base does not exist error message when you. Data quality services is a knowledgedriven solution that analyzes data based upon knowledge that builds with dqs. With this custom transform task, you can use the knowledge base kb created in dqs to automate data matching. Feb 24, 2012 adventureworks sample for data quality services dqs to demonstrate domain management, cleansing, and matching capabilities in dqs. Newest dataqualityservices questions stack overflow.

May 10, 2016 the house price data includes a county column that has all sorts of random values in it unclean. As dqs allows us to create a knowledge base by discovering, building and managing the information or knowledge about the data, we will first create a knowledge base, then we will use that knowledge base for cleansing the data. Download the house price data use dqs to tidy the county column. For example, you might get data about customers from two different sources. The following example uses an artificial dataset on passenger records required for security screening 8. In reality you can easily use sql server table for the same.

Technet adventureworks sample for data quality services dqs this site uses cookies for analytics, personalized content and ads. This control is really super in that it will pass incoming data to the data quality services knowledge base that we just created. Knowledge base management is how you define the data cleansing rules and policies. Knowledge bases contain domains, which are the equivalent to columns or attributes in a database. When you try to export a dqs knowledge base that contains domains in the dqs. Knowledge base creation is initially a computerguided process. Data quality service an overview sciencedirect topics. The topics which are covered in this online video training course on dqs are.

Matching with dqs sql server 2017 integration services cookbook. This dataset requires cleansing operations because some of the passenger names and other. Getting started with data quality services of sql server 2012. How to use sql server data quality services to ensure the. Error when you export a dqs knowledge base that contains. This enables to create data quality processes that continually enhances the knowledge about data and in so doing, continually improves the quality of data. For that basic knowledge in ssis is helpful, since the dqs components are used together with ssis tasks and components. Oh22 data has just released a free ssis transform task for sql server data quality services dqs matching. On the start screen, the knowledge base management area on the left displays the knowledge bases that you have already defined. Sql server installing data quality services dqs on sql. Before you can start using the data cleansing component in ssis, you need to make sure you have already created and published a knowledge base for cleansing your source data. How to clean master data services data using data quality.

The knowledgebase does not exist as it professionals, we always take an approach during development of devtestprod or at least devprod. This topic describes the default knowledge base, dqs data, which is installed with data quality services dqs. Introduction to data quality services dqs of sql server. A dqs kb is a grouping of related data quality definitions and rules called domains that are. Sql server data quality services dqs linkedin learning.

853 157 909 211 574 655 1564 54 1246 30 20 1551 1286 478 764 1411 1039 234 1068 639 449 1174 309 566 1260 396 143 273 217 566 290 1336 1418 916 200